
Back in 2002, Michelle Light was the Artist Guest of Honor at Technicon, the local Science Fiction/Fantasy convention in Blacksburg, VA. She was a wonderful guest, and if you ever have the chance to meet her, do go up and say hi. Anyway, she hosted a panel on how to draw like Michelle Light. I was the only guy attending the panel, but it was fun.
The upshot was that I briefly attempted to draw furry heads in her style, or at least, starting from her style. I made six pictures in total before I lost interest. This is the picture I drew at her panel. I think it's a feline of some sort.
